One of the most frequent uses of Mizol is in the treatment of onychomycosis, commonly known as nail fungus. This condition can be persistent and unsightly, often causing thickening, discoloration, and even crumbling of the nails. Mizol offers a potential solution to restore the health and appearance of affected nails.
Another common application is the treatment of tinea versicolor, a fungal infection that leads to patches of discolored skin. These patches can range in color from light brown to almost white, often causing cosmetic concerns. Mizol’s antifungal properties aim to effectively treat this condition, restoring even skin tone.
Mizol can also be used to treat athlete’s foot (tinea pedis), a fungal infection affecting the feet, particularly between the toes. This condition frequently causes itching, burning, and scaling, making daily activities uncomfortable. Mizol’s targeted action helps to alleviate these symptoms and promote healing.

Before applying Mizol, it’s essential to thoroughly clean and dry the affected area. This removes any dirt, debris, or excess moisture that could interfere with the medication’s absorption and effectiveness. A clean, dry surface allows for better penetration and optimal results. Gently pat the area dry with a clean towel.
Apply a thin layer of Mizol directly to the affected skin or nail, ensuring complete coverage of the infected area. It’s important to extend the application slightly beyond the visibly affected zone to prevent the spread of the fungus. A small amount of Mizol goes a long way, so avoid over-application.
The frequency of application will depend on the specific instructions provided with your Mizol product and the type of infection being treated. Generally, once-daily application is sufficient, but your doctor may recommend a different schedule depending on your individual needs and condition severity. Always follow your doctor’s advice.
After applying Mizol, allow it to dry completely before covering the area. Avoid applying heavy dressings or occlusive bandages, as these can trap moisture and potentially hinder the treatment’s effectiveness. Let the area breathe to promote proper absorption and avoid potential irritation from trapped moisture.

The length of time you need to use Mizol depends greatly on the type and severity of your fungal infection, as well as your individual response to the treatment. Some infections clear up relatively quickly, while others may require a more extended treatment period. Patience and consistency are key to achieving optimal results.
For mild cases of fungal infections, you might see improvement within a few weeks of consistent application. However, it’s crucial to continue using Mizol as directed, even if you notice an improvement in symptoms. Stopping treatment prematurely can lead to recurrence of the infection, prolonging the overall healing process.
More severe or persistent infections, such as those involving nails, often require a longer course of treatment, sometimes lasting several months or even longer. Nail infections tend to respond more slowly because the fungus is deeply embedded within the nail structure. Regular application and patience are essential for these cases.
Your healthcare provider can provide a more accurate estimate of the treatment duration based on your specific condition and response to the medication. They will likely monitor your progress and adjust the treatment plan as needed. Regular check-ups help ensure the infection is clearing effectively.
